WebA shanty town or squatter area is a settlement of improvised buildings known as shanties or shacks, typically made of materials such as mud and wood. A typical shanty town is squatted and in the beginning lacks …
WebA shack generally implies a tiny, run-down building which is being used as a house but isn't really a proper home. A hut is used to describe more primitive kinds of houses, small and probably made with thatched roofs, the kind of shelter you might see in the TV show LOST.
